Steel-High defeats Delone Catholic 42-20

Top-seeded Steelton-Highspire defeated No. 2 Delone Catholic 42-20 to win the District 3 Class 1A title in back-to-back seasons Saturday afternoon at Veterans Memorial Field in Harrisburg.

Daivin Pryor rushed for 118 yards and a score and also had a receiving touchdown and an interception to lead the Rollers (8-2) to their second consecutive title.

Steel-High went undefeated last season and won the PIAA Class 1A state title. It started this season 7-0 before two straight losses to Big Spring 49-14 and Boiling Springs 29-28 put a damper on the end of the regular season.

The Rollers put those losses behind them in the district final.

“My mindset was to just get out here and win this week,” Pryor said. “We had a good team coming in here that really wanted it badly. A couple of years back they beat us on this field and then we went out there and beat them on their field. They came back, so we wanted to do it again.”

The Squires (6-5) beat Steel-High 39-27 in a 2019 district semifinal; the Rollers evened the score in 2020 with a 23-13 victory in the district final.

Losing a Division I talent like Penn State commit Mehki Flowers, who transferred to Central Dauphin East after helping Steel-High win the state title last season, would put a strain on any team. The Rollers showed the capability of performing on the same level, averaging 55 points per game in their 7-0 start. The 35-point loss to Big Spring and a one-point heartbreaker to Boiling Springs to end the season hurt, but the Rollers showed moxie in rebounding in the district final.

“It all was a long process,” Pryor said on attempting to match what Steel-High did in 2020. “It started back in the summer and spring. We had to work, watch the film, go in the weight room. Every practice we were here working hard. In the end, we had to execute and that’s what we did.”

It didn’t start ideally for the Rollers and Pryor as the running back fumbled on the first possession and Delone Catholic’s Brady Dettinburn recovered at the 15. Dettinburn eventually ran it in from 5 yards out and the Squires went up 7-0 with 10:01 left in the first.

Alex Erby hit Tyrone Moore on a 28-yard pass to tie it with 3:12 left.

Pryor got the only score of the second quarter with a 5-yard run to make it 13-7 with 42.3 seconds left in the half.

Erby hit Jaieon Perry for a 12-yard score with 9:14 left in the third and it seemed as though Steel-High was about to roll with a 21-7 lead.

Delone Catholic responded with a 68-yard pass from Ryder Noel to Gage Zimmerman and the Squires were back within a score at 21-14.

It was all Rollers from there.

Jakhai Noss pounded it in from 5 yards out with 1:31 left in the third. Erby hit Rell Ceaser Jr. for a 10-yard touchdown with 6:48 left in the fourth. Erby hit Pryor for a 21-yard score with 4:49 in the fourth and the scoreboard read 42-14.

Noel hit Dylan Staub for a 13-yard TD with 1:03 left in the game for an empty score.

The Rollers will play District 4 Class 1A champ Canton next week in the first round of the PIAA state tournament.

Is another state championship on the mind?

“Yessir,” Pryor said with a smile.

 

STATS:

Steelton-Highspire

Passing: Erby 6-11-1–82 (4 TD).

Rushing: Pryor 20-118 (TD), Noss 14-59 (TD), Ceaser Jr. 2-9, Moore 1-7, Erby 4-(-8). Total: 41-185 (2 TD).

Receiving: Moore 3-39 (TD), Pryor 1-21 (TD), Perry 1-12 (TD), Ceaser Jr. 1-10 (TD).

Penalty: 4-25.

Punt-avg: 3-36.6.

First downs: 12.

Fumbles-lost: 3-1.

Delone Catholic

Passing: Noel 8-12-1–116 (2 TD).

Rushing: Keller 12-50, Staub 9-26, Dettinburn 8-17 (TD), Noel 14-1. Team: 43-94 (TD).

Receiving: Staub 4-41 (TD), Zimmerman 2-81 (TD), Dettinburn 1-5, Keller 1-(-11).

Penalties: 7-46.

Punt-avg: 4-29.8.

First downs: 7.

Fumbles-lost: 2-1.

Scoring Summary

Steelton-Highspire (8-2) 7 6 16 13 – 42

Delone Catholic (6-5) 7 0 7 6– 20

1st Quarter

DC-Dettinburn 5 run (Emeigh kick) – 10:01

SH-Moore 28 pass from Erby (Moore kick) – 3:12

2nd Quarter

SH-Pryor 5 run (Moore kick missed) – :42.3

3rd Quarter

SH-Perry 12 pass from Erby (Pryor run) – 9:14

DC-Zimmerman 68 pass from Noel (Emeigh kick) – 6:04

SH-Noss 10 run (Pryor run) – 1:31

4th Quarter

SH-Ceaser Jr. 10 pass from Erby (Moore kick) – 6:48

SH-Pryor 21 pass from Erby (Moore kick missed) – 4:49

DC-Staub 13 pass from Noel (Noel pass failed) – 1:03
